Not the happy new year we had wanted so far 🙁 

Just got a call from our vets that the margins were not there from histopathology reports of the nerve sheath tumor so Ava's amputation surgery was not curative.   She still needed the surgery though and her chest x-ray prior to surgery was clear.   Radiation could be an answer but my family and I are not sure we want to go down that path.

She is doing so well 13 days post op almost and has the sparkle back in her eyes and we want to preserve that for as long as we can.

Our hearts are breaking.
